What is a Remote Relocate job?

A Remote Relocate job refers to a position where employees work remotely but may be required or offered the opportunity to relocate to a different city, state, or country. These roles are often designed for workers who prefer the flexibility of remote work but are open to moving for company needs, team integration, or long-term assignments. Employers may provide relocation assistance or incentives to help with the transition. The specific requirements and relocation policies vary by employer and job type, so it's important to clarify details before accepting a position.

What are some common challenges faced by employees in a remote role that requires occasional relocation, and how can they be managed?

Employees working remotely with occasional requirements to relocate may face challenges such as adapting to new time zones, managing work-life balance during transitions, and staying connected with their teams. It's important to establish clear communication channels and make use of collaboration tools to remain engaged. Proactively planning relocation logistics and setting routines can help maintain productivity and minimize disruption. Many organizations also provide relocation support and resources, so it's beneficial to inquire about these before starting.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Relocation Spec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Relocation Specialist, you need strong organizational skills, knowledge of relocation processes, and often a background in HR, real estate, or global mobility. Familiarity with relocation management software, HRIS systems, and global compliance regulations is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and cultural sensitivity are standout soft skills in this role. These capabilities ensure smooth transitions for relocating employees and contribute to client satisfaction and operational efficiency.
